Transaction 2cec3a5c6240681a945aca555cf566cd74f9006e4fcdf9865076e5f4f92ebf1a
1 Input
1 Output
-
2cec3a5c6240681a945aca555cf566cd74f9006e4fcdf9865076e5f4f92ebf1a:0
- value
- 499997925
- script pubkey
- OP_0 OP_PUSHBYTES_20 dcb5ea8f520923dde6ee7b00cf33a38dfad2191f
- address
- bc1qmj674r6jpy3amehw0vqv7var3hadyxgl3n99ck